Statement by John Kerry on International Court of Justice Ruling Regarding Israel's Security Fence
7/9/2004 3:21:00 PM
To: National Desk
Contact: Mark Kitchens of John Kerry for President, 202-464-2800; Web: http://www.johnkerry.com
BEAVER, W.V., July 9 /U.S. Newswire/ -- Senator John Kerry released the following statement today regarding the International Court of Justice ruling on Israel's security fence:
"I am deeply disappointed by today's International Court of Justice ruling related to Israel's security fence. Israel's fence is a legitimate response to terror that only exists in response to the wave of terror attacks against Israel. The fence is an important tool in Israel's fight against terrorism. It is not a matter for the ICJ.
"I have made very clear from the start that I do not believe that the ICJ should even be considering this issue given that they do not have jurisdiction.
"We were right to oppose the resolution in the General Assembly and to convey this opinion to the ICJ. Several months ago, I joined in sending a letter to UN Secretary General Kofi Annan urging him to "act so that the ICJ does not...issue an advisory opinion on the legality of the security fence Israel is building."
"Our nation is rightly discussing with Israel the exact route of the fence to minimize the hardship it causes Palestinians. And Israel's own Supreme Court has looked at the very same issues and we should respect that process."
